Part of the walls of the cast-in-place tunnel in the west artificial island of the Shenzhen-Zhongshan Link are curved structures with gradually changing curvature.In order to adapt to the construction of the tunnel arc-shaped structure,the construction technology of steel-timber composite arc-shaped formwork was studied by combining the preliminary design and field process verification.The engineering practice has proved that this technology can better solve the problem of low generality of curved wall formwork with variable curvature.Compared with conventional custom steel formwork or random wood formwork system,the steel-timber composite arc-shaped formwork system has obvious advantages in quality,safety and cost control,which can provide reference for similar projects.
